When it comes to choosing the right material for making high-traffic area rugs and carpets, there are a few factors to consider. Durability, comfort, and cost are all important considerations when selecting the best material for your needs. The most common materials used for making carpets and rugs are nylon, polyester, wool, and olefin. Each of these materials has its own unique characteristics that make it suitable for different applications.
Nylon is one of the most popular materials used for making carpets and rugs. It is highly durable and resistant to wear and tear, making it ideal for high-traffic areas. Nylon is also relatively inexpensive, making it a great choice for budget-conscious shoppers.
Polyester
is another popular material used for making carpets and rugs.It is highly stain-resistant and easy to clean, making it a great choice for busy households. Polyester is also relatively inexpensive, making it a great option for those on a budget.
Wool
is a natural material that is often used in high-end carpets and rugs. It is extremely durable and resistant to wear and tear, making it ideal for high-traffic areas.Wool is also naturally stain-resistant and easy to clean, making it a great choice for busy households. However, wool can be expensive, so it may not be the best option for those on a budget.
